**Deploy Guide — Step 4: Archiving Cold Storage Buckets**

Okay, the fun part. Once the retention sweep marks a bucket as cold, the archiver job compresses it and ships it to the Frostvale tier. Don't kick this off during business hours — it hogs egress. Double-check the manifest count matches the sweep report before you confirm, because un-archiving is painful. The archiver authenticates to the Frostvale endpoint with a dedicated deploy key, which you'll find below.

deploy key for kajof-fajop: bky6_gDHw9Q

Hi — handover notes on deep-link routing in the Swiftbramble app before I'm out next week. Short version: all inbound links go through LinkGate, which validates the host allowlist and strips query params we don't recognize before routing. The sketchy part worth a security pass is the legacy promo-link handler, which still accepts unsigned payloads and routes straight to the webview. I've flagged it but haven't had time to fix it. Full routing table and known gaps are written up on the internal page.

runbook for tafof-yawif: https://confluence.tolvaqsys.internal/display/display/browse/pages/7be3

Subject: Key rotation for Fillwise restock planner

Team, as flagged in last week's sync, we are rotating credentials for the Fillwise vending-machine restock planner today. The old key stops working Friday at noon. This affects the route optimizer, the stock-level poller, and the nightly forecast job; nothing else talks to Fillwise directly. Update your local env files and the shared staging config before Friday. CI secrets have already been swapped by the platform group. The new key for internal use is below.

gateway credential: kto23_LX9A4ys6i4nzHtpOLNLodKK